FMA Act Determination 2007/06 – Section 32 (Transfer from the Department of Industry, Tourism and Resources to the Department of Resources, Energy and Tourism)

Financial Management and Accountability Act 1997

I, Tim Youngberry, Division Manager, Financial Reporting and Cash Management Division, Department of Finance and Deregulation, make this Determination under subsection 32(2) of the Financial Management and Accountability Act 1997
(FMA Act).


This Determination is made because of changes in the administrative arrangements on 3 December 2007, specifically the abolition of the Department of Industry, Tourism and Resources, and the transfer of resources, energy and tourism related functions to the Department of Resources, Energy and Tourism.

1              Name of Determination

This Determination is the FMA Act Determination 2007/06 – Section 32 (Transfer from the Department of Industry, Tourism and Resources to the Department of Resources, Energy and Tourism).

Note  This Determination has been made by a delegate of the Secretary of the Department of Finance and Deregulation. The Secretary is a delegate of the Minister for Finance and Deregulation: see sections 53 and 62 of the FMA Act.

2              Commencement

This Determination is taken to have commenced on 3 December 2007.

Note  Under subsection 32(8) of the FMA Act, a Determination may be expressed to take effect before its making and registration under the Legislative Instruments Act 2003.

3              Amendment of Appropriation Act (No. 1) 2007-2008

The Appropriation Act (No. 1) 2007-2008 is amended as specified in Schedule 1.

Note  An amount of $32,187,366 of the departmental item for the Department of Industry, Tourism and Resources is transferred to the Department of Resources, Energy and Tourism. An amount of $135,458,690.84 of the administered item for Outcome 1 of the Department of Industry, Tourism and Resources is transferred to the Department of Resources, Energy and Tourism.

Note  The Appropriation Acts, as made, refer to the names of particular Departments. However, some of those references have changed due to the reorganisation of government functions. The changes are:

(a) the Industry, Tourism and Resources Portfolio ceased to exist and the Innovation, Industry, Science and Research Portfolio was established.

(b) the Department of Industry, Tourism and Resources was abolished and the Department of Innovation, Industry, Science and Research was established.

(c) the Resources, Energy and Tourism Portfolio was established

(d) the Department of Resources, Energy and Tourism was established.
